简单粗暴,通过 js 的navigator.userAgent 方法:

if (navigator.userAgent.indexOf("Edg") > -1) {
    document.documentElement.className += " edge";
  } else if (navigator.userAgent.indexOf("Chrome") > -1) {
      document.documentElement.className += " chrome";
  }

在写样式的时候,前面加上前缀就可以区分了。

<style>
.edge .el-table th.gutter{
  width: 10px;
}
.chrome .el-table th.gutter{
  width: 6px;
}
</style>